    SPRING: an RCT study of probiotics in the prevention of gestational diabetes mellitus in overweight and obese women
    Nitert, MD ; Barrett, HL ; Foxcroft, K ; Tremellen, A ; Wilkinson, S ; Lingwood, B ; Tobin, JM ; McSweeney, C ; O'Rourke, P ; McIntyre, HD ; Callaway, LK (BMC, 2013-02-25)
    BACKGROUND: Obesity is increasing in the child-bearing population as are the rates of gestational diabetes. Gestational diabetes is associated with higher rates of Cesarean Section for the mother and increased risks of macrosomia, higher body fat mass, respiratory distress and hypoglycemia for the infant. Prevention of gestational diabetes through life style intervention has proven to be difficult. A Finnish study showed that ingestion of specific probiotics altered the composition of the gut microbiome and thereby metabolism from early gestation and decreased rates of gestational diabetes in normal weight women. In SPRING (the Study of Probiotics IN the prevention of Gestational diabetes), the effectiveness of probiotics ingestion for the prevention of gestational diabetes will be assessed in overweight and obese women. METHODS/DESIGN: SPRING is a multi-center, prospective, double-blind randomized controlled trial run at two tertiary maternity hospitals in Brisbane, Australia. Five hundred and forty (540) women with a BMI > 25.0 kg/m(2) will be recruited over 2 years and receive either probiotics or placebo capsules from 16 weeks gestation until delivery. The probiotics capsules contain > 1x10(9) cfu each of Lactobacillus rhamnosus GG and Bifidobacterium lactis BB-12 per capsule. The primary outcome is diagnosis of gestational diabetes at 28 weeks gestation. Secondary outcomes include rates of other pregnancy complications, gestational weight gain, mode of delivery, change in gut microbiome, preterm birth, macrosomia, and infant body composition. The trial has 80% power at a 5% 2-sided significance level to detect a >50% change in the rates of gestational diabetes in this high-risk group of pregnant women. DISCUSSION: SPRING will show if probiotics can be used as an easily implementable method of preventing gestational diabetes in the high-risk group of overweight and obese pregnant women.

    Rapid assay to assess colonization patterns following in-vivo probiotic ingestion.
    Tobin, JM ; Garland, SM ; Jacobs, SE ; Pirotta, M ; Tabrizi, SN (Springer Science and Business Media LLC, 2013-07-05)
    BACKGROUND: Colonization of the intestine with some microorganisms has been shown to have beneficial health effects. The association of bacteria with its human host starts soon after birth; however in infants born prematurely establishment of normal intestinal flora is interrupted with colonization with potential pathogenic organisms Probiotic supplementation may therefore be beneficial to the health of preterm infants. As most probiotic organisms are difficult to culture, confirmation of their colonization after supplementation is difficult. In this study, rapid qPCR assays for detection of presence of probiotic species in the intestine by faecal sampling is described in both preterm infant and adult participants. FINDINGS: Probiotic colonization was determined using qPCR directed at amplification of organisms present in the ingested probiotic Streptococcus thermophilus, Bifidobacterium animalis subsp. lactis and B. longum subsp. infantis. Overall, differential detection of probiotic strains in faeces were found between adult and preterm infants, with 50% of infants continuing to shed at least two probiotic strains three weeks after probiotic ingestion had ceased. CONCLUSIONS: This study demonstrated rapid assessment of the preterm infant gut for colonization with probiotic strains using real-time PCR. This method would be of great importance in studies of probiotics in prevention of diseases and adverse clinical outcomes.

    Social exclusion, infant behavior, social isolation, and maternal expectations independently predict maternal depressive symptoms
    Eastwood, J ; Jalaludin, B ; Kemp, L ; Phung, H ; Barnett, B ; Tobin, J (WILEY, 2013-01)
    The objective of the study was to identify latent variables that can be used to inform theoretical models of perinatal influences on postnatal depressed mood and maternal-infant attachment. A routine survey of mothers with newborn infants was commenced in South Western Sydney in 2000. The survey included the Edinburgh Postnatal Depression Scale (EPDS) and 46 psychosocial and health-related variables. Mothers (n = 15,389) delivering in 2002 and 2003 were surveyed at 2-3 weeks for depressive symptoms. Nonlinear principal components analysis was undertaken to identify dimensions that might represent latent variables. Correlations between latent variables and EPDS >12 were assessed by logistic regression. A five-dimension solution was identified, which accounted for 51% of the variance among the items studied. The five dimensions identified were maternal responsiveness, social exclusion, infant behavior, migrant social isolation, and family size. In addition, the variable maternal expectation contributed significantly to total variance and was included in the regression analysis. Regression on EPDS >12 was predictive for all variables except for maternal responsiveness, which was considered an outcome variable. The findings are consistent with the proposition that social exclusion, infant behavior, social isolation among migrant mothers, and maternal expectations are determinants of maternal mood.

    Introducing an online community into a clinical education setting: a pilot study of student and staff engagement and outcomes using blended learning
    Gray, K ; Tobin, J (BMC, 2010-01-26)
    BACKGROUND: There are growing reasons to use both information and communication functions of learning technologies as part of clinical education, but the literature offers few accounts of such implementations or evaluations of their impact. This paper details the process of implementing a blend of online and face-to-face learning and teaching in a clinical education setting and it reports on the educational impact of this innovation. METHODS: This study designed an online community to complement a series of on-site workshops and monitored its use over a semester. Quantitative and qualitative data recording 43 final-year medical students' and 13 clinical educators' experiences with this blended approach to learning and teaching were analysed using access, adoption and quality criteria as measures of impact. RESULTS: The introduction of the online community produced high student ratings of the quality of learning and teaching and it produced student academic results that were equivalent to those from face-to-face-only learning and teaching. Staff had mixed views about using blended learning. CONCLUSIONS: Projects such as this take skilled effort and time. Strong incentives are required to encourage clinical staff and students to use a new mode of communication. A more synchronous or multi-channel communication feedback system might stimulate increased adoption. Cultural change in clinical teaching is also required before clinical education can benefit more widely from initiatives such as this.
